Hi!!! Former Teavana employee! Teavana was a tea company that was bought up by Starbucks a few years ago. They used to specialize in loose leaf tea, but now it's Starbuck's more high-end teas (I'm assuming) compared to Tazo. I'm sure that out of the US, the Teavana name gave Starbucks a lot more tea options because the original company had contacts with various tea gardens. Love your videos!
